Seaton Tramway
Seaton Tramway is a heritage railway with a difference. The trams are narrow gauge and follow the old British Railway route between Seaton and Colyton, which used to be part of the branch line between Seaton and ‘Seaton Junction’ at the London – Exeter mainline. Most trams are double decker with the open top deck offering beautiful views across the Seaton Wetlands. Keep eye on their website for some great winter specials too, such as 'Polar Express'.
The South Devon Railway
Running between Buckfastleigh and Totnes, this railway follows the river Dart, allowing for some great photographic opportunities. This is also why the South Devon Railway is such a firm favourite with TV and film production companies. If you've even just watched one Agatha Christie production, you've probably seen this railway in action!
Paignton - Dartmouth Steam Railway
Connecting Paignton on the mainline railway with Dartmouth, this heritage line follows a stunning route, which includes a halt at Greenway, the former home of Agatha Christie. An ideal trip out in combination with the regular train from Exeter to Paignton, following the famous Dawlish Loop. Or a few hours in beautiful Dartmouth.
West Somerset Railway
The West Somerset Railway connects Minehead with Bishops Lydeard. In fact, it is connected to the mainline at Taunton, but heritage trains do not alight there. Designed by Brunel, there has been a railway here for almost 175 year. Great railway journey to combine with a day out on Exmoor.
Pecorama
Pecorama, at just 20 minutes from Mazzard Farm in the stunning fishing village of Beer, is not a heritage railway as such, but since it is part of the model railway factory PECO, does offer all things trains. Model railways YOU can control, as well as a lovely miniature train you can travel on and which offers the most stunning views. Great gardens and play facilities too!
